           I want you to remain mindful of your source of strength. Sometimes you are aware of me. Other times you walk out from under me. When you walk out from under me, you are pelted with the enemy’s arrows. I have provided protection and given you authority, but it is only found under me. My grace gives you the ability to turn back into me. It is sufficient power to secure your victory. If you are under a storm of hail, I have given you the ability to step under my protection. But you must step out and over through faith. Life will always come to this place of choosing your way or my way. I hold out my hand to you, but you must take it because I have always given you the freedom to choose. I long for you to choose life and put away the things that bring harm to you because I care deeply for you. I long to gather you in my arms and shelter you. If you believe me, I will make your feet like hinds feet in high places. ~God

Psalm 27:5 For He will conceal me in His shelter in the day of adversity; He will hide me under the cover of His tent;

Deuteronomy 30:19 I call heaven and earth as witnesses against you today that I have set before you life and death, blessing and curse. Choose life so that you and your descendants may live, love the Lord your God, obey Him and remain faithful to Him. For He is your life, and He will prolong your life in the land He swore to give to your fathers Abraham, Isaac and Jacob.

Psalm 106:24 they despised the pleasant land and did not believe His promise.

1 Corinthians 1:25 because the foolishness of God is wiser than men; and the weakness of God is stronger than men.

Habakkuk 3:19 The Lord God is my strength; and He will make my feet like hinds’ feet, and He will make me to walk upon mine high places.
